Ruby Caroline O'Mara, 90, of Central Square, passed away on Wednesday with family by her side as the sun shone through her window. She was a loving mother, grandmother and great-grandmother. She was born to Stephen and Leona Hasto in Albion, NY, as the 5th of seven children. Ruby graduated from Mexico High School and went on to be a telephone operator, taking a break to raise her children, then returning to NY Telephone where she retired in the late '80s. Ruby was a life-long Parishioner of Divine Mercy Parish and served as the organist for many years at St. Michael's. Family gatherings were important events for Ruby and she cherished making those moments special. She especially loved Christmas and would hold an annual yard lighting celebration. She was predeceased by her husband, Robert, in 1987.
She is survived by her children, Patricia (George) Walter, Paul (Cynthia) O'Mara, Mark (Debbie) O'Mara, Michael (Monica) O'Mara, John (Colette) O'Mara, Janet (Elena) O'Mara; 18 grandchildren; 19 great-grandchildren; sister, Ann Edwards; sisters-in-law, Theresa O'Mara and Doris Hasto; and many nieces and nephews.
